How To Be Grateful In Hard Times

Finding Gratitude in Life’s Struggles

It’s easy to be thankful when everything is going well, but when life gets difficult, gratitude can feel like an impossible choice. Hard times can bring pain, frustration, and confusion, and it’s natural to feel overwhelmed or discouraged. Yet, in the midst of our struggles, gratitude remains a powerful tool that can transform our hearts and help us navigate even the toughest seasons.

“Give thanks in all circumstances; for this is God’s will for you in Christ Jesus.”1 Thessalonians 5:18

Choosing gratitude in hard times is not about denying the reality of your struggles; it’s about shifting your focus from the problem to the hope you have in Christ. Let’s explore how to cultivate gratitude even in the most challenging moments.

1. Recognize the Presence of God in Your Struggles

When facing hardship, it’s easy to feel isolated or abandoned. However, one of the first steps to gratitude is remembering that God is with you in your struggles. He doesn’t promise a life free of pain, but He promises to be present through it all.

“The Lord is close to the brokenhearted and saves those who are crushed in spirit.”Psalm 34:18

Encouragement:
In times of difficulty, remind yourself that God is with you. His presence is a constant source of comfort and peace, and knowing that He is near helps us find gratitude, even when circumstances are hard.

2. Focus on What You Still Have, Not What You’ve Lost

It’s natural to focus on what’s going wrong when life feels overwhelming. However, shifting your focus to what you still have can bring you a renewed sense of gratitude. Take time to recognize the blessings in your life, no matter how small they may seem.

“Bless the Lord, O my soul, and forget not all His benefits.”Psalm 103:2

Practical Tip:
Write down three things you’re thankful for every day. These could be simple blessings—like your health, the support of a friend, or even a warm meal. Practicing gratitude regularly helps you to see beyond your struggles and focus on the goodness of God.

3. Trust That God Is Working in Your Life

Even in hard times, we can be assured that God is always working for our good. He uses challenges to refine us, build our faith, and prepare us for something greater. Gratitude in these moments is rooted in trust that God is in control, even when we don’t understand what’s happening.

“And we know that in all things God works for the good of those who love Him, who have been called according to His purpose.”Romans 8:28

Encouragement:
Remember that God can bring good out of even the most difficult situations. While we may not see the full picture, we can trust that He is working in and through our circumstances for our ultimate good.

4. Use Prayer to Shift Your Perspective

Prayer is a powerful tool for cultivating gratitude in hard times. It’s a way to express your pain and frustration, while also acknowledging God’s faithfulness. When you pray, you invite God to transform your perspective, replacing fear and anxiety with peace and thankfulness.

“Do not be anxious about anything, but in every situation, by prayer and petition, with thanksgiving, present your requests to God. And the peace of God, which transcends all understanding, will guard your hearts and your minds in Christ Jesus.”Philippians 4:6-7

Practical Tip:
In moments of struggle, pause and pray. Thank God for what He’s done in your life, even if it’s just one thing. Ask for His help and guidance, but also express your trust in His will. Prayer helps shift our focus from the problem to the One who holds the solution.

5. Look for Opportunities to Serve Others

Sometimes, when we’re feeling down, the best way to cultivate gratitude is to serve others. Helping someone in need not only blesses them but also reminds us of the things we may take for granted. It brings perspective and helps us focus on what we can give rather than what we are lacking.

“Each of you should use whatever gift you have received to serve others, as faithful stewards of God’s grace in its various forms.”1 Peter 4:10

Practical Tip:
Find someone who could use encouragement, whether it’s a neighbor, friend, or stranger. A small act of service—like a kind word, a helping hand, or a prayer—can shift your focus away from your own difficulties and bring joy to both you and the person you serve.

6. Reflect on the Hope We Have in Christ

One of the most powerful reasons we can be grateful, even in hard times, is the hope we have in Jesus Christ. The ultimate act of love—Jesus’ sacrifice on the cross—has secured our salvation and eternal hope. No matter what we face here on earth, we have the assurance of God’s eternal promise.

“Praise be to the God and Father of our Lord Jesus Christ! In His great mercy He has given us new birth into a living hope through the resurrection of Jesus Christ from the dead.”1 Peter 1:3

Encouragement:
When you’re feeling overwhelmed, remember that your struggles are temporary, but your hope in Christ is eternal. Focus on the ultimate victory we have in Jesus—His death, resurrection, and the promise of eternal life.

7. Choose Gratitude, Even When It’s Hard

Gratitude is a choice, not a feeling. In hard times, it’s easy to feel like giving thanks is impossible, but when we choose to be grateful, even for small things, we align our hearts with God’s will. Gratitude helps us to see beyond the immediate pain and reminds us of God’s presence and faithfulness.

“Rejoice always, pray continually, give thanks in all circumstances; for this is God’s will for you in Christ Jesus.”1 Thessalonians 5:16-18

Encouragement:
Choosing gratitude doesn’t mean ignoring the pain—it means acknowledging that, even in suffering, God is good. Let your gratitude be a declaration of trust in His goodness and sovereignty.

Conclusion: Gratitude in Hard Times

Choosing gratitude in difficult times isn’t always easy, but it is always rewarding. It shifts our focus from what we lack to what we have, deepens our relationship with God, and brings peace to our hearts. When we choose to be grateful—despite our circumstances—we are reflecting the heart of God and trusting in His faithfulness.

“Give thanks to the Lord, for He is good; His love endures forever.”Psalm 107:1

In every season, God is with us. Let gratitude be the lens through which we view our lives, knowing that, even in the hardest moments, He is working for our good and His glory.
